构建智慧社区:业主版前端模板深度解析

需积分: 9 1 下载量 106 浏览量 更新于2024-11-13 收藏 876KB RAR 举报
资源摘要信息:"智慧家园业主版前端模板" 知识点: 1. 智慧家园与智慧社区概念: 智慧家园通常指的是在传统住宅的基础上,融入现代信息技术,包括物联网、云计算、大数据分析等,以实现家居环境的智能化控制和管理。智慧社区则是智慧家园概念的延伸,指的是在更广阔的社区范围内,提供更加智能的物业服务、社区管理以及居民互动交流平台,从而提升居民的生活品质和社区的整体运营效率。 2. 前端模板概念及应用: 前端模板是指预先设计好的HTML结构与CSS样式,通常还包括JavaScript脚本,用于快速搭建网站或者应用程序的用户界面部分。它能够让开发者在无需从头编写代码的情况下,通过修改模板内容来创建个性化的页面布局和样式,极大地提高了开发效率和一致性。 3. uni-app框架: uni-app是一个使用Vue.js开发所有前端应用的框架,可以编译到iOS、Android、H5、以及各种小程序等多个平台。它提供了丰富的组件和API,可以帮助开发者构建高性能、跨平台的应用程序。 4. 文件名称解析: - main.js:通常是JavaScript的入口文件,负责初始化整个应用。 - pages.json:配置文件,用于定义uni-app应用中各个页面的路径、窗口表现、导航条、底部标签等。 - manifest.json:配置文件,包含应用的元数据,例如应用名称、图标、权限等,是构建应用时不可或缺的一部分。 - package-lock.json:用于锁定安装的npm包的版本,确保团队成员和部署环境之间的一致性。 - package.json:配置文件,记录项目的依赖信息和脚本命令等,是Node.js项目的核心配置文件。 - README.md:文档文件,通常包含项目的介绍、安装方式、使用方法等重要信息。 - uni.scss:样式文件,一般用于存放全局通用的CSS样式,比如字体大小、颜色定义等。 - App.vue:应用程序的入口组件,是页面的根组件,每个页面都是在App.vue的基础上进行的。 - components:目录名,通常存放项目中复用的Vue组件。 - static:目录名,存放静态资源文件,如图片、音频、视频等。 5. 智慧社区在前端实现可能涉及的技术点: - 响应式设计:确保网页能够适应不同尺寸的屏幕,提供良好的用户体验。 - 数据可视化:使用图表等工具展示社区能耗、安全、居民活动数据等。 - 前端安全:对敏感操作进行加密处理,防止用户数据泄露。 - 用户界面(UI)设计:设计简洁、直观的用户界面,提升用户的操作体验。 - 移动端适配:优化用户在移动设备上的交互体验,包括触摸操作和布局适配。 6. 智慧家园业主版前端模板可能包含的功能模块: - 个人中心:管理个人信息、家庭成员信息、安全设置等。 - 通知公告:查看社区最新通知、新闻和公告。 - 费用管理:查询和支付物业费、水电费等。 - 服务预约:预约维修、清洁等服务。 - 社区互动:参与社区活动、发起话题讨论。 综上所述,智慧家园业主版前端模板是一个集成了现代前端技术的综合性模板,它能够帮助开发者快速构建出一个功能完备、操作简便、界面友好的社区服务应用,为居民提供便利的在线服务平台。